Ownership of a critical function: managing the Rapid Recon CRM that tracks every vehicle from arrival to sale-ready
What you'll doManage and maintain accurate, up-to-date vehicle records in the Rapid Recon CRM
Coordinate vehicle repairs directly with outside vendors, from scheduling through completion
Provide leadership with frequent, clear updates on vehicle status and repair costs
Organize and log administrative paperwork in the CRM, working closely with the Back of House team
Log current mileage for all on-site vehicles weekly in Dealer Center
Research vendors and vehicle parts to support the Inventory Manager
Help schedule service appointments and monitor repair timelines
Upload receipts and invoices into Rapid Recon and keep work orders current
Walk the lot weekly to flag vehicles needing touch-up paint, wheel repair, interior work, or washing
Report any check-engine lights or mechanical concerns to the Inventory Manager
Monitor and document vehicle deliveries and pickups according to RP Exotics standards
